Unfortunately the EPA in their infinite wisdom has decreed that it is not legal for a recycler to sell a used cat converter for re-use. Therefore all the recycling / junk yard type places are only allowed to recycle them for the precious metals. That is why when you go to the jy, all the cats have been snipped off.

If your engine light is coming on and code is for O2 it's the cat in-between the O2 sensors. My code popped up 2years ago for my passenger cat on my 2013. I installed spacers on both sides after cat O2 sensors and have not had a code since. There like 8bucks for a pair of O2 spacers on ebay. The third cat is not monitored.
